 +**How to forward your Avenue e-mail**  
 + 
 + 
 +To forward your Avenue e-­mail to an external e­‐mail address (including your McMaster address) first go to the E-­mail tool in Avenue: 
 + 
 + 
 +Once in your Avenue e-mail, click on Settings: 
 + 
 + 
 +\\  
 +{{:​mail_2.png?​nolink&​300|}} 
 + 
 + 
 +Scroll down to the Forwarding Options and select the Forward checkbox: 
 + 
 + 
 +\\  
 +{{:​mail_4.png?​nolink&​300|}} 
 + 
 + 
 +Once you select the checkbox, you can choose whether you want to keep a copy in your Inbox and whether you want to mark it as read or keep it as unread in Avenue.

 +**Tracking activity in Avenue mail**  
 + 
 +How to track recipient activity in Avenue mail for messages sent to internal email addresses (Avenue email addresses):​ 
 + 
 +This setting, when turned on, tracks the status of a sent message (read or unread), when the message was replied to, and if the message was forwarded. When this setting is enabled, sent messages will contain a View Recipient Activity link in their message body. 
 + 
 +To enable this feature, go the mail tool and click settings. Select the checkbox 'Track activity for messages sent to internal email addresses',​ and click '​Save'​ to save the setting.
